WebFeb 24, 2024 · Phil Mickelson. When it comes to Phil Mickelson, the gambling problem that brought his addiction into the limelight culminated in 2012. Namely, the famous golfer got into a severe gambling debt in Las Vegas. The Mickelson gambling debt was $1.95 million to a well-known businessman and gambler, William “Billy” Walters. WebApr 29, 2016 · Sports Wagering. NCAA rules prohibit participation in sports wagering activities and from providing information to individuals involved in or associated with any type of sports wagering activities concerning intercollegiate, amateur or professional athletics competition.
